Abstract

The utility model relates to automatic production equipment for lampshades. The equipment comprises a raw material grabbing, heating and baking unit, a lampshade forming unit and a finished product transmission unit, wherein the raw material grabbing, heating and baking unit, the lampshade forming unit and the finished product transmission unit are connected in sequence to form the automatic production equipment provided by the utility model; the raw material grabbing, heating and baking unit is used for grabbing raw material boards and placing the raw material boards on a baking oven to heat and bake; the lampshade forming unit is used for grabbing the raw material boards heated and baked by the raw material grabbing, heating and baking unit and placing the raw material boards into a forming unit to shear and form; the finished product transmission unit is used for transmitting and collecting the finished products of the lampshades, which are sheared and formed by the lampshade forming unit.

Background technology
The life that has been used in very widely people as the various light fixture products of lighting apparatus has suffered; for general light fixture, in its structure, all comprise lampshade; lampshade is not only to cover on the effect for light is flocked together on lamp; it can also prevent from getting an electric shock simultaneously; protection eyes are also had to effect, so all can have lampshade on most of lamp.
The processing step of producing at present lampshade generally comprises, and first by hand sheet material is put into Baking out on baking box or baking oven and (reaches the forming temperature needing) after a period of time.By manual, baked sheet material is put in forming machine, forming machine matched moulds is blown and is reached certain briquetting pressure and make it stretching and fit in die cavity again.Finally, die sinking after cooling certain hour moulding, more then manual taking-up arrive next procedure manual excision rim charge, cleaning has packed whole operation, this traditional mode of production, and production efficiency is low, and the quality of product can not be protected, and this is the major defect for conventional art.

The specific embodiment
As shown in Figures 1 to 3, a kind of automation equipment of producing lampshade, it comprises that raw material capture heat baking unit, lamp shade forming unit and finished product transmission unit.
This raw material capture heat baking unit, this lamp shade forming unit and this finished product transmission unit and are linked in sequence and form automation equipment of the present utility model.
This raw material capture the baking unit of heating in order to material plate 10 is captured, and this material plate 10 is placed into the baking of heating on baking oven 20.
This lamp shade forming unit is in order to carry out shear forming by capture the baking unit of heating this material plate 10 is captured and being placed on after baking of heating through this raw material in shaping machine set 30.
This finished product transmission unit is in order to transmit collection by the finished product lampshade 40 after this lamp shade forming unit shear forming.
These raw material capture the baking unit of heating and comprise raw material grabber 110 and baking oven group 120, and wherein, this baking oven group 120 comprises some these baking ovens 20.
This material plate 10 is the sheet material of rectangle, circle or other materials, this raw material grabber 110 is sucker grabber, because manufacturing this material plate 10 of lampshade is sheet material, so utility model people is through facts have proved in a large number, select sucker grabber can promote crawl efficiency, guarantee to capture quality, the utility model Whole Equipment fault rate is reduced.
This sucker grabber comprises longitudinal drive part and horizontal driving section, and this longitudinal drive part can drive this sucker grabber in the vertical direction to move back and forth, and this horizontal driving section can drive this sucker grabber to move back and forth in the horizontal direction.
This longitudinal drive part and this horizontal driving section can be utilized respectively the elements such as slide rail, cylinder, oil cylinder to realize its motion and drive function.
This sucker grabber comprises sucker support bar and some suckers, and some these suckers are separately positioned on this sucker support bar end, by this sucker, can make this sucker grabber capture this material plate 10.
This material plate 10 is stacked to be placed on raw material station, and this raw material grabber 110 captures this material plate 10 be placed on this baking oven 20 one by one.
This lamp shade forming unit comprises semi-finished product grabber 210 and this shaping machine set 30, and this semi-finished product grabber 210 is semi-finished product sucker grabber.
This semi-finished product sucker grabber comprises longitudinal drive part and horizontal driving section, this longitudinal drive part can drive this semi-finished product sucker grabber in the vertical direction to move back and forth, and this horizontal driving section can drive this semi-finished product sucker grabber to move back and forth in the horizontal direction.
This longitudinal drive part and this horizontal driving section can be utilized respectively the elements such as slide rail, cylinder, oil cylinder to realize its motion and drive function.
This semi-finished product sucker grabber comprises sucker support bar and some suckers, and some these suckers are separately positioned on this sucker support bar end, by this sucker, can make this semi-finished product sucker grabber capture this material plate 10 through these baking oven 20 heating.
This semi-finished product grabber 210 by this material plate 10 through these baking oven 20 heating, captures and is placed in this shaping machine set 30 one by one.
This shaping machine set 30 comprises frame 31.
This shaping machine set 30 also comprises forming unit, and this forming unit positions, shears, blows in order to this material plate 10 to through these baking oven 20 heating the type that is stretched into and moves, and makes this material plate 10 be processed to this finished product lampshade 40.
This forming unit is fixedly installed in this frame 31, and this forming unit comprises fixed clamp part and mould part, and wherein, this fixed clamp part is carried out clamping location in order to this material plate 10 to through these baking oven 20 heating.
This stationary gripping part is divided and is comprised left deckle board 61 and right deckle board 62, and this left deckle board 61 and this right deckle board 62 are slidably arranged on middle deckle board slide rail 63, and in this, deckle board slide rail 63 is fixedly installed on this frame 31 middle parts.
This left deckle board 61 and this right deckle board 62 are connected with center sheet drive 64 respectively, and this center sheet drive 64 can utilize the driver parts such as cylinder, oil cylinder to make.
This center sheet drive 64 can drive respectively this left deckle board 61 and this right deckle board 62 on deckle board slide rail 63, to carry out in opposite directions in this and oppositely move back and forth.
On this left deckle board 61 and this right deckle board 62, offer respectively holddown groove 65, when this left deckle board 61 and this right deckle board 62 move toward one another and when being merged together, this holddown groove 65 and this holddown groove 65 of this right deckle board 62 of this left deckle board 61 can merge.
On this left deckle board 61 and this right deckle board 62, be respectively arranged with lock pin 66, when this left deckle board 61 and this right deckle board 62 move toward one another and when being merged together, this lock pin 66 and this lock pin 66 of this right deckle board 62 of this left deckle board 61 lock mutually, to fix the relative position between this left deckle board 61 and this right deckle board 62.
This mould part comprises cope match-plate pattern 71 and lower bolster 72, and wherein, this cope match-plate pattern 71 is arranged on the top of this fixed clamp part, this lower bolster 72 below of being arranged on this fixed clamp part corresponding with this cope match-plate pattern 71.
This cope match-plate pattern 71 is connected with cope match-plate pattern driver, and this cope match-plate pattern 71 of this cope match-plate pattern driver drives pumps, and this lower bolster 72 is connected with lower bolster driver, and this lower bolster 72 of this lower bolster driver drives pumps.In concrete enforcement, this cope match-plate pattern driver and this lower bolster driver can be hydraulic jack.
Mould 73 is connected to the bottom of this cope match-plate pattern 71, this mould 73 is in order to carry out moulding to this finished product lampshade 40, these lower bolster 72 tops are provided with cutter fixing support 74, on this cutter fixing support 74, be provided with cutting tool 75, in this fixed clamp part, this material plate 10 through these baking oven 20 heating is carried out behind clamping location, this lower bolster 72 moves upward, and can cut this material plate 10, to generate the edge of this finished product lampshade 40 by this cutting tool 75.
Below this lower bolster 72, be provided with blowing moulding device, this blowing moulding device can produce air-flow upwards, this air-flow acts on the bottom surface of this material plate 10 after passing this lower bolster 72 and this cutter fixing support 74, and these material plate 10 middle positions of pushing tow move upward, until this material plate 10, completely by being attached on the inner surface of this mould 73, moves to the drawing and forming of this material plate 10 thereby complete.
Between this left deckle board 61, this right deckle board 62 and this lower bolster 72, be respectively arranged with interlock clamping apparatus 76, this interlock clamping apparatus has non-clamping and clamping two states.
In this fixed clamp part, this material plate 10 is carried out to clamping location, when 75 pairs of these material plates 10 of this cutting tool cut and this material plate 10 is carried out to drawing and forming action to this blowing moulding device, this interlock clamping apparatus is in non-clamp position, this moment, distance between two these interlock clamping apparatus is greater than the width of this finished product lampshade 40, and two these interlock clamping apparatus do not contact with this finished product lampshade 40.
When this blowing moulding device completes the drawing and forming action to this material plate 10, this left deckle board 61, this right deckle board 62 are opened, when this cope match-plate pattern 71 is separated from each other with this lower bolster 72, two these interlock clamping apparatus move toward one another, are converted to clamp position by non-clamp position.
When this interlock clamping apparatus is in clamp position time, distance between two these interlock clamping apparatus is less than the width of this finished product lampshade 40, this moment, two these interlock clamping apparatus clamp this finished product lampshade 40 and make the left deckle board 61 of this finished product lampshade 40 and this, this right deckle board 62, this mould 73 and this lower bolster 72 separated.Thereby make this finished product lampshade 40 can enter into this finished product transmission unit.
In concrete enforcement, when clamping this finished product lampshade 40, two these interlock clamping apparatus make this finished product lampshade 40 and this left deckle board 61, this right deckle board 62, this mould 73 and this lower bolster 72 after separatings, this left deckle board 61, this right deckle board 62, after this mould 73 and this lower bolster 72 move to respectively corresponding initial position, two these interlock clamping apparatus are further converted to non-clamp position by clamp position, this moment, because the distance between two these interlock clamping apparatus is greater than the width of this finished product lampshade 40, so effect by gravity, this finished product lampshade 40 falls and drops on this lower bolster 72, thereby make this finished product lampshade 40 can enter into this finished product transmission unit.
This finished product transmission unit comprises inclination stripper 310 and conveyer belt 320.
This finished product lampshade 40 is slipped on this conveyer belt 320 and is carried out finished product transmission by this inclination stripper 310 in this forming unit.
The above-mentioned various piece of the utility model can be connected respectively with automation processor in concrete enforcement, the detailed operation contents such as the duty of this automation processor control various piece, run duration, move distance, thereby realize the automatic operating of integral device, this automation processor can be single-chip microcomputer, data processor etc.
In concrete enforcement, finished product grabber 81 is connected in this frame 31, and this finished product grabber 81 can capture this finished product lampshade 40 in this forming unit, this finished product lampshade 40 is entered on this conveyer belt 320 and carry out finished product transmission.This finished product grabber 81 is finished product sucker grabber, this finished product sucker grabber comprises longitudinal drive part and horizontal driving section, this longitudinal drive part can drive this finished product sucker grabber in the vertical direction to move back and forth, this horizontal driving section can drive this finished product sucker grabber to move back and forth in the horizontal direction, this longitudinal drive part and this horizontal driving section can be utilized respectively slide rail, cylinder, the elements such as oil cylinder are realized its motion and are driven function, this finished product sucker grabber comprises sucker support bar and some suckers, some these suckers are separately positioned on this sucker support bar end, by this sucker, can make this finished product sucker grabber capture this finished product lampshade 40.
In concrete enforcement, some these baking ovens 20 are set in sequence in rotation baking sheet 82, this rotation baking sheet 82 is driven and can be rotated according to predetermined instruction by rotary electric machine 83, this raw material grabber 110 captures this material plate 10 one by one, and this material plate 10 is placed into the baking of heating of corresponding this baking oven 20, through this material plate 10 of heating after baking, by the rotational action of this rotation baking sheet 82, be transferred to this semi-finished product grabber 210 belows, and deliver in this shaping machine set 30 and carry out shear forming by these semi-finished product grabber 210 crawls.
